Where Gunstages Script Shines Online
Gunstages Script works best as a decorative accent or for short phrases. It's not meant for long paragraphs or dense blocks of text, but rather for headlines, section titles, buttons, and logo text. I've seen it perform exceptionally well on portfolio sites, coaching websites, and course sales pages where a warm, inviting tone is essential.
For example, on a creative portfolio homepage, Gunstages Script can be used for the main title, giving the site a personal and artistic feel. On a boutique online store, it could be used for product banners or promotional sections to add character and draw attention to key messages.
It also pairs well with other fonts. I’ve found that combining it with a simple sans serif font like Montserrat or Open Sans creates a balanced look that's both stylish and readable. For a more editorial feel, pairing it with a clean serif font like Lora or Merriweather can work wonders in digital magazines or blog redesigns.
Considerations for Using Gunstages Script Digitally
While Gunstages Script is a fantastic choice for many web projects, there are some considerations to keep in mind. Because it's a decorative script font, it may not be suitable for small navigation text, form labels, or accessibility-focused interfaces. It's better suited for display purposes rather than for large bodies of text.
Before using Gunstages Script on your website, make sure to check the available styles, weights, and alternates. Some script fonts come with swashes and ligatures that can enhance the visual appeal of your design. Also, confirm that the font supports the languages you need and that you have the appropriate commercial license if you're using it for client projects or online stores.
Lastly, ensure that the font is optimized for fast loading. Many premium fonts offer webfont versions that load quickly and render smoothly across different devices and browsers. This is especially important for landing pages and e-commerce sites where performance can impact user experience and conversion rates.
